Sprache für Telnetkommunikation (evtl. graf. Oberfläche und Parameterübergabe)

te one

Lt. Commander
Registriert
Apr. 2009
Beiträge
1.255
Hallo,

ich bin auf der Suche nach einer Programmiersprache mit der ich möglichst einfach ein paar Telnetkommandos versenden kann (evtl. auch was zurückempfange).
Eine kleine grafische Oberfläche würde ich gerne auch damit basteln.

Erfahrung habe ich hauptsächlich in PHP und Python (wobei ich in Python noch nichts grafischen gemacht habe. Geht aber wohl?!).
Ansonsten habe ich auch schon ein paar Erfahrungen mit C, C++, C# und Java sammeln dürfen.
Wäre super wenn man nicht großartig zusätzliche Programme zum benutzen braucht (z.B. Python-to-Exe oder sowas). Außerdem wäre es super, wenn ich dem Programm Parameter übergeben könnte, damit dann entsprechend ein Telnet-Kommando abgesetzt wird.

Vielen Dank schonmal.
Weiß nicht so ganz, was ich da am besten nehme.
Gruß
 
so oder so mußt du entweder einen Webserver oder ein Programm installieren zur Remoteausführung auf einem Fremd PC
 
Python hat schon einen Telnet Client in der Standardbibliothek: http://docs.python.org/library/telnetlib.html
Einfach GUI geht mit TCL, auch in der Standardbibliothek. Für aufwändigere Sachen kann man gtk, Qt, etc nehmen. Eigentlich fast alles.
Python braucht halt einen Python Interpreter. Die einzigste Sprache die du genannt hast die das nicht braucht ist C/C++.
 
?
Von welchem Gerät redest du? Vom Telnet-Server auf dem die Kommandos dann verarbeitet werden? Das ist ein Mikrocontroller.

Und ansonsten brauch ich eben auf mehreren anderen Rechnern nur die möglichkeit automatisch Telnet-Kommandos dorthin zu schicken. Und das sollte eben mit möglichst wenig Installationsaufwand geschehen (z.B. die Windows-Telnet-Exe hinschieben und dann per Batch aufrufen. Leider reichen mir die Batch-Befehle nicht ganz aus)
Ergänzung ()

@Mumpitzelchen:
Könnte man Python nicht immer zu ner Exe konvertieren?
Telnet hab ich damit auch schon genutzt. Das ging ganz gut :)
 
Doch kann man. Py2Exe kann das: das pack die notwendigen Python DLL(s) und dein Script alles zusammen in eine große .exe Datei und fertig.
 
Ah genau. Dachte doch, dass ich das auch schonmal irgendwann gemacht hatte.

Dann werde ich Python hierfür mal testen. Ich denke die grafische Oberfläche müsste reichen
 

Ähnliche Themen

Zurück
Oben